From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 4094 invoked by alias); 19 Mar 2014 10:07:53 -0000 Mailing-List: contact zsh-users-help@zsh.org; run by ezmlm Precedence: bulk X-No-Archive: yes List-Id: Zsh Users List List-Post: List-Help: X-Seq: 18631 Received: (qmail 4264 invoked from network); 19 Mar 2014 10:07:48 -0000 X-Spam-Checker-Version: SpamAssassin 3.3.2 (2011-06-06) on f.primenet.com.au X-Spam-Level: X-Spam-Status: No, score=-1.9 required=5.0 tests=BAYES_00 autolearn=ham version=3.3.2 Date: Wed, 19 Mar 2014 11:00:16 +0100 From: Roman Neuhauser To: Ray Andrews Cc: zsh-users@zsh.org Subject: Re: set -F kills read -t Message-ID: <20140319100016.GC53100@isis.sigpipe.cz> References: <140316122727.ZM11132@torch.brasslantern.com> <140316131323.ZM11227@torch.brasslantern.com> <5327B941.3060605@eastlink.ca> <140317235020.ZM30413@torch.brasslantern.com> <532872BE.1020408@eastlink.ca> <140318104505.ZM15560@torch.brasslantern.com> <5328C3D8.9020603@eastlink.ca> <140318181703.ZM3474@torch.brasslantern.com> <53292481.5090300@eastlink.ca>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<53292481.5090300@eastlink.ca> User-Agent: Mutt/1.5.21 (2010-09-15) # rayandrews@eastlink.ca / 2014-03-18 22:00:49 -0700: > Ok, then how else would one write a function that could use arguments > *or* piped input? repeating another post on this thread: mygrep() { if [ -t 0 ]; then echo terminal else read input echo $input input fi } -- roman